TICKET-4471: TideBoard widget build failing signature verification on deploy to the Gullhaven edge cluster. Pipeline rejects the tide-table bundle at the verify step; checksum matches, signature does not. Started after last night's CI runner rebuild — old key likely wiped from the agent. No user impact yet, cached bundle still serving. Re-provision the signer and rerun job 8821. Use the current signing key below.

signing key of bagap-yawep = bky13_TbfT6ZMUoGJo2

## Authentication

During the Tollgrange cron drift investigation, we found the scheduler host clock skewing roughly 40 seconds per day, which broke token timestamps and caused intermittent 401s from downstream jobs. Until NTP hardening ships, the drift-probe script must authenticate to the internal Chronoledger service on every run rather than caching tokens, since cached tokens expire mid-window. On-call engineers triggering the probe manually should export the service key shown below first.

gateway credential: kto3_qfe

**Key Ceremony Checklist — Step 4 (Support)**

Quick one: before the ceremony wraps, confirm report exports are pinned to UTC, not the signer's laptop timezone — last quarter we got off-by-a-day timestamps in the audit bundle. Tick the box, get a second pair of eyes, then unlock the export console with the passphrase below.

vault phrase of kawep-tahog = ulaix-briath

**Checklist item 7: Verify cold-start latency for Quillbarn handlers**

Before sign-off, trigger at least five cold invocations of each serverless handler in the Quillbarn ingestion tier by scaling the pool to zero and waiting past the idle timeout. Record p95 init duration; anything over 1.8 seconds blocks the release. Pay special attention to the `manifest-parse` handler, which loads a large schema bundle at startup. Attach your measurements to the release page, noting the exact build under test directly beneath this item.

trace token, fafog-kageg: htk4_98e6